WebSep 20, 2024 · Federally Qualified Health Centers (FQHCs) offer a wide variety of services including: Preventive health services. Dental services. Prenatal care. Mental health and substance abuse services. Transportation services necessary for adequate patient care. Hospital and specialty care. Medicare Part-B covered drugs prescribed by a certified …
